To determine which material is least affected by chemical weathering, we need to understand what chemical weathering is and how it works.

Chemical weathering is the process by which rocks, minerals, and other materials are broken down or altered through chemical reactions. These reactions are often caused by exposure to water, air, or other substances in the environment. As a result, the material's composition can change, leading to erosion or degradation over time.

Now, let's examine the given options and consider which material would be least affected by chemical weathering:

1. A pile of tiles made of feldspar: Feldspar is a common mineral found in many types of rocks. While feldspar can be susceptible to weathering, it does not undergo significant chemical changes under normal environmental conditions. However, if the tiles are exposed to water or other reactive substances for an extended period, some chemical weathering could occur. So, this option is not the correct answer.

2. A statue made of marble: Marble is a type of metamorphic rock composed mainly of calcite, which is a calcium carbonate mineral. Calcite is particularly vulnerable to chemical weathering, especially when exposed to acidic substances. Over time, the acid in rainwater or pollution can dissolve the calcite in marble and cause significant damage. Therefore, a statue made of marble is likely to be affected by chemical weathering.

3. A bridge made of iron rods: Iron is highly susceptible to corrosion, especially when exposed to moisture and oxygen. The chemical reaction between iron, water, and oxygen leads to the formation of iron oxide (rust), which weakens the structural integrity of the metal. Consequently, a bridge made of iron rods is highly affected by chemical weathering.

4. A chair made of plastic: Plastic is a synthetic material that is generally resistant to chemical weathering. It is not easily degraded by exposure to water or oxygen, so it tends to be quite durable in outdoor environments. Therefore, a chair made of plastic would be the least affected by chemical weathering compared to the other options provided.

In summary, the chair made of plastic would be the material least affected by chemical weathering among the given options.
